To stop taking Tekturna (aliskiren), it's essential to consult your healthcare provider first. They can provide guidance on safely discontinuing the medication and may recommend a tapering schedule or alternative treatments for managing your condition. Do not abruptly stop taking it without professional advice, as this could lead to a resurgence of blood pressure issues. Always follow your doctor's instructions for the best outcomes.
Tekturna can be described as a drug that is prescribed to treat high blood pressure. Tekturna can produce some rare side effects to include an upset stomach, bloody urine, joint pain, loss of consciousness or swelling of the feet.
